What Is Interventional Cardiology?

Interventional cardiology is a branch of cardiology focused on treating heart and capillary conditions with minimally invasive treatments. As opposed to making big surgical incisions, interventional cardiologists utilize thin, flexible tubes called catheters, which are inserted with blood vessels– usually via the wrist or groin– to reach the heart.

Using real-time imaging support, medical professionals can detect issues and perform treatments from inside the cardio system. These procedures are commonly done in a specific area called a heart catheterization laboratory, or “cath laboratory.”

Unlike typical open-heart surgical procedure, several interventional treatments require just local anesthesia, much shorter healthcare facility remains, and considerably less recuperation time.

The Role of Interventional Cardiology in Treating Cardiovascular Disease

Among the most important payments of interventional cardiology is the treatment of coronary artery condition, a problem caused by the build-up of plaque inside the arteries that supply blood to the heart.

When an artery comes to be narrowed or blocked, the heart might not receive sufficient oxygen-rich blood, resulting in breast pain (angina) or a cardiac arrest. Interventional cardiologists can recover blood flow via procedures such as:

Coronary Angioplasty and Stenting

Coronary angioplasty involves inserting a little balloon with a catheter to broaden a tightened artery. In a lot of cases, a stent– a tiny mesh tube– is positioned to keep the artery open and preserve blood circulation.

The prevalent use of coronary stents has become a significant development in dealing with people with acute coronary syndromes, including cardiac arrest.

Percutaneous Coronary Intervention (PCI).

PCI is a more comprehensive term that consists of angioplasty and stent positioning. It is among the most commonly done interventional cardiology treatments and has ended up being a typical therapy for several people experiencing blocked coronary arteries.

Emergency PCI can be lifesaving throughout a cardiovascular disease due to the fact that bring back blood flow rapidly can restrict damage to the heart muscle.

Past Arteries: Shutoff and Structural Heart Therapies.

Modern interventional cardiology has actually increased far beyond treating obstructed arteries. Today, specialists can also treat several architectural heart conditions making use of catheter-based strategies.

Transcatheter Aortic Shutoff Substitute (TAVR).

Aortic shutoff condition, specifically aortic constriction, takes place when the heart’s aortic shutoff becomes tightened and can closed correctly. Typically, valve substitute needed open-heart surgical procedure.

TAVR has transformed therapy by allowing doctors to replace the harmed valve utilizing a catheter-based strategy. The new valve is supplied with a capillary and expanded inside the existing valve.

This strategy has given a vital therapy choice for lots of people, consisting of older adults and those who might have higher risks related to surgery.

The Benefits of Minimally Intrusive Heart Treatments.

The development of interventional cardiology is mainly driven by the advantages these procedures supply compared to standard surgical treatment.

Secret advantages include:.

Much shorter recovery periods: Several patients return to regular activities sooner because procedures involve smaller gain access to points as opposed to large surgical injuries.

Lower physical anxiety: Minimally invasive techniques can decrease blood loss, infection risks, and overall stress on the body.

Improved therapy alternatives: Clients that might not be suitable candidates for major surgery can often get reliable catheter-based therapies.

Better patient experiences: Reduced health center remains and quicker recuperation can enhance comfort and lifestyle.

However, interventional procedures are not ideal for every client. Therapy decisions rely on elements such as overall health and wellness, illness seriousness, makeup, and individual dangers.

The Significance of Advanced Innovation.

The continued development of interventional cardiology depends greatly on development. Modern cath laboratories make use of sophisticated imaging systems, robotics, artificial intelligence, and enhanced clinical gadgets to enhance precision and safety.

Technologies such as intravascular ultrasound (IVUS) and optical coherence tomography (OCT) enable medical professionals to analyze capillary from within and make more precise therapy decisions. Artificial intelligence may further support diagnosis, treatment planning, and customized treatment in the future.

Robotic-assisted systems are additionally being discovered to boost step-by-step control and lower radiation direct exposure for clinical groups.

The Future of Interventional Cardiology.

The future of interventional cardiology is expected to bring much more tailored and less intrusive therapies. Scientists continue to establish smaller gadgets, boosted imaging methods, and brand-new methods for treating formerly difficult cardio conditions.

Emerging areas include biodegradable stents, progressed heart valve innovations, catheter-based treatments for heart failure, and the combination of expert system right into cardio treatment.

As populations age and cardiovascular disease remains a global obstacle, interventional cardiology will certainly continue to play a vital duty in enhancing survival rates and boosting individual results.
